Pacifier The star of season 2, Frank Grillo, opened at the incredibly violent interrogation scene between Rick Flag SR and Chris Smith by John Cena.
Before the return of the HBO Max program at the end of August, I sat with a cricket to discuss the brutal flag sr beating of the titular antihero in the fifth episode this season. Complete spoilers continue immediately for season 2 so far and 2021 The suicide squad.
Pacifier Episode 5 of season 2, entitled ‘Back to the Suture’, go to Flag SR finally get what he wanted for years: the opportunity to brutally hit the man who killed his son.
Remember, in The suicide squadSmith murders Rick Flag Jr but, until Flag SR is becoming the new Argus chief, he does not know who is responsible for the death of his son. Once he finds out, Flag SR spends the entire season 2, to this point, anyway, trying to locate the peacemaker.
In a nutshell, he is finally face to face with Smith after the latter is arrested at the beginning of ‘Back to the Suture’. After telling his deputies of Argus Sasha Bordeaux and Langston Fleury to leave himself already Smith in an interrogation room, Flag SR does not waste time distributing a longer punishment, without mentioning absolutely ruthless, to the eponymous character.

As Cricket testifies, the director of Episode 6, Alethea Jones, the co -president of DC Studios, James Gunn, the series of acrobatics of the series and his acting partner at dinner were the whole game to do it as visceral and hard as possible.
“Violence is so connected to the emotions that has been bottled and has been building [for some time]”Grillo said about the battle of the beating that deals with one of the best the second season of HBO Max Shows.” [the anger] It’s like an eruption volcano [out of him]Then they let me go as far as possible. John [Cena]In particular, he was a champion because he did not want me to contribute to me.
“They [Gunn, Cena, and Jones] It really lets Flag Mr have its moment, “Grillo continued.” And, although he understands it, there is still a level of frustration due to the way Peacemaker really does not correspond and simply lets happen. Therefore, it is a bit short for the flag, because it is very unilateral. He does not receive as much satisfaction as he expected, and I think it is a great narrative choice. “
The dissatisfaction of which Grillo speaks is the result that Flag SR is prevented from being submitted to Smith to submit. With Emilia Harcourt and John Economos intervening by “reserving” Smith, that is, registering his arrest, through the Argus database, Flag SR is forced to release Smith on bail.
That does not mean that Flag SR has finished with Smith in the DC Universe (DCU) television program. Smith could have left its original reality for the seemingly idyllic alternative dimension with which it has become obsessed, but with three episodes of the last season of the DCU project chapter one yet to come, another confrontation can occur.
Gunn, the main writer of the program and primary director, has also suggested so much. When asked who would win a fight between Smith and Flag SR in the last installment of the official Pacemaker podcast, Gunn implied that another fight could be in process before the end of season 2.
